@Harvestmouse
I answer to No1. All the rest is put up as food for though. There is no name attached to it. If I wanted to direct to you, I would have done that.

1. I think that TV, and especially the rules are the cause, and not the effect. Lets say I would change my playstyle, that would not change a word in the rules. Nor would anybody else's change in playstyle would change the rules. So I simply don't accept that people are the cause instead of the rules. The way how play is a reflection of the rules, so this reflection is the effect of the rules.

You may perceive that changing people is easier than changing the rules. If you assume that rules wont change, then you would probably try hard changing people. But I find this so wrong on multiple levels.

Ok, that's a good argument. Generally I'm on the side of authority compared to liberalism but not by much. So I don't agree, but I do see your point.

My point of view is this:

I have been playing this game since nigh on the start. As a GW game the fluff was integral, and without the internet to discuss tactics, gaming the system and passing that advice on wasn't common.

I'm in Blood Bowl for life, I can say that now I think. My worry is that we have some severe flaws and no way of addressing them. I am seeing powergamers come in and abuse those flaws. What happens if they abuse it enough that there isn't a new blood, it's becomes too niche? The powergamers aren't winning as much as they want and move onto a new game.

In short you move into my environment, break it and move on. I think as a community we do have an affect on some aspects of power gaming. An example being some of the Scandinavian Zon box minmaxers stopped. I think pier pressure or pier respect had a lot to do with that.
